High impact information on darmin

  • Xenopus Darmin showed zygotic expression in the early endoderm and later became restricted to the midgut [1].
  • In an unbiased secretion cloning screen of Xenopus gastrula embryos we isolated a novel gene, designated Darmin [1].
  • Darmin encodes a secreted protein of 56 kDa containing a peptidase M20 domain characteristic of the glutamate carboxypeptidase group of zinc metalloproteases [1].
 

Biological context of darmin

  • The endoderm-specific expression of Darmin makes this gene a useful marker for the study of endoderm development [1].
